Synopsis
The A List: 15 Stories from Asian and Pacific Diasporas is a 2026 documentary that follows fifteen influential Asian and Pacific voices as they reflect on identity, belonging, racism, success, and what it means to navigate life in America while staying connected to their cultural roots. Through deeply personal conversations and real-life experiences, the film explores how each participant has shaped their own journey while representing different communities, careers, and generations. From actors and activists to athletes, journalists, entrepreneurs, and artists, the documentary creates an intimate portrait of resilience, heritage, and representation across Asian and Pacific diasporas.

Who directed The A List: 15 Stories from Asian and Pacific Diasporas?
The documentary was directed by Eugene Yi. He is an award-winning filmmaker and editor known for projects including Free Chol Soo Lee and The Rose: Come Back to Me, with work featured at Sundance and Tribeca.
How long is The A List: 15 Stories from Asian and Pacific Diasporas?
The documentary has a runtime of 1 hour and 24 minutes.
Is The A List connected to HBO’s previous “List” documentaries?
Yes. The documentary is part of “The List” documentary series created by Timothy Greenfield-Sanders. Earlier films in the collection include The Black List, The Latino List, The Women’s List, and The Trans List, all focused on personal identity and representation.
